Presented by Jolene MacDonald – Founder, Accessibrand
Creating a brand that includes everyone from the beginning isn’t just the right thing to do, it’s smart business. This in-person workshop will guide early-stage entrepreneurs through the practical steps to build an inclusive and accessible brand, even on a tight budget.
Led by award-winning creative director and accessibility advocate Jolene MacDonald, you’ll learn:
- What branding really means (it’s more than a logo!)
- How to choose accessible fonts, colours, and visuals
- Tips for inclusive messaging and social media
- Free tools to help you get started with confidence
You’ll leave with free resources and simple next steps to make your brand clear, consistent, and inclusive.

About Jolene
Jolene MacDonald (she/her) is the founder of Accessibrand, Canada’s first accessibility-focused creative agency led entirely by people with lived disability experience. With over 25 years in branding and design, Jolene is also an accessibility advocate, speaker, and educator, helping entrepreneurs and organizations build more inclusive brands, services, and teams. Accessibrand also offers self-paced and customized training programs with Accessibrand Academy.
